IGP announces Rs124m for dams fund

LAHORE: Punjab IGP Dr Syed Kaleem Imam on Friday announced about Rs124m donation from the Punjab police officers and officials for construction of dams while launching a campaign ‘save water’.

Keeping in view the intensity of the problem, the IGP said 184,000 employees of Punjab Police would deposit their two-day pay while officials their one-day salary to the accounts opened by Chief Justice Saqib Nisar for construction of Bhasha and Mohmand dams.

He said the police had always been taking initiatives for public service in times of terrorism, floods, earthquakes or other natural calamities. He said professionals from all the fields should contribute to resolve the water issue so that new dams could be constructed as soon as possible.

He directed the officers to avoid the wastage of water in police lines, training colleges, police stations and other offices by ensuring the smooth implementation of ‘save water’ campaign.
